Out of Place

Images plaster the walls of my mind

Pictures of the what every girl should look like

Perfect bodies, bleach blond hair

Standing up on a pedestal , looking godlike

 

Then  a glimmer catches my eye

The grace of a girl, but a frown lines her face

As she looks into the mirror, she'll shed a tear

She doesn't look like them , she's simply out of place
